Description

This workshop is a beginning level introduction to exploring mixed-media elements in artworks with an emphasis on surface building with artist M.W. Dugger. Together we will explore the history of mixed media art making and explore narrative and storytelling through various mark making as well as photo transfers, layering, and composition.
 
Surface building includes layering, scratching into, sanding back, and other methods of creating texture and depth. In addition, we will discuss archival techniques and also exhibition and display considerations. Each student will walk away from the class with at least three pieces of work. Additionally, you will leave this class with an understanding of how to use image transfers and techniques to build surfaces for future artworks.
